nSignia eSTP for Transport Optimization

 

Much like an IP router, nSignia eSTP creates the possibility for IP-based subnetworks in a telecom service provider’s signaling space. Using SIGTRAN protocols (M2PA, SUA, and M3UA), service providers can extend or combine SS7 network segments transparent to existing equipment, optimizing where performance or cost considerations demand it.


As one might expect, IP transport can be significantly less expensive than SS7 transport. This enables service providers to extend the hybrid network model back into the SS7 core networks,
creating IP-based, core signaling networks that have islands of SS7 located at their edges. This creates the possibility that the edge of the network becomes a two-way transition zone,
allowing services to migrate in both directions as economics dictate.

 

Use cases for nSignia eSTP for transport optimization include its deployment for long haul and back haul link and as a signaling hub.
